RADIO NOTES

Regular Sessions at YA stations 5 | to 6 p.m.: Children's sessions; 6 to | 7 p.m. Dinner Music; 7 to 8 p.m: News and reports. WEDNESDAY IYA AUCKLAND 7.30 Harriet Cohen, piano 8..") Jean Menzies, contralto 8.17 Auckland String Players 8.28 Parry Jones, tenor 8.30 The String Players 8.44 Parry Jones, tenor S. 45 The String Players 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Evening Prayer 0.30 Bundles 10.0 The Masters in Lighter Mood. 2YA WELLINGTON 7.45 Debroy Soniers Band 7.49 Team Work 8.14 By Candle Light 5.34 Decca Salon Orchestra 8.46 For our Irish listeners. 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Evening Prayer 9.30 Melody Time 9.44 At Eventide 10.5 Dance music. SYA CHRISTCHURCH 7.30 Evening programme 7.39 Readings by O. L. Simmance 8.0 Harmonic Society 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Evening Prayer 9.30 Heifetz, violin 10.2 Music, mirth and melody. 4YA DUNEDIN. 7.30 The Grand Orchestra 7.36 Cappy Rieks 8.1 Kurt Engel, xylophone 8.7 'Krazy Kapers 8.34 The' Coral Islanders 8.39 Raymond Newell, baritone 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Evening Prayer 9.30 The Orchestra 9.33 Sorrell and Son 9.57 Arthur Young, piano 10.0 Dance music. THURSDAY IYA AUCKLAND, 7.30 The Concert Orchestra 7.45 Winter Course Talk 7.55 The 1 Concert Orchestra 7.58 Webster Booth, tenor 8.4 Hillingdon Orchestra 8.9 Harold Williams, baritone 8.29 Tango Tunes 8.42 When Dreams Come True 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Music by British Bands 9.31 Dad and Dave 10.0 Dance music. 2YA WELLINGTON 7.45 Rainbow Rhythm 8.6 Madman's Island 8.19 Voiices in Harmony 8.25 Hometown Variety 8.45 Here's a Laugh 9.0 NBS neAvsreel 9.25 Wellington Harmonic Society 10.0 The Masters in Lighter Mood. 3YA CIIRISTCHURCH 7.30 The Theatre Orchestra 7.40 Billy Bunter of Greyfriars 7.53 Carson Robison's Buckaroos: 8.7 Surfeit of Lampreys 8.24 Decct Concert Orchestra 8.33 The Old Crony 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Dick Jurgen's Orchestra 4YA DUNEDIN* 7.30 Symphony Orchestra 7.40 Richard Tauber, tenor 7.44 Lloyd Powell, piano 8.3 Rauta Waara, soprano 8.33 Fcodor Chaliapin, bass 8.44 The Halle Orchestra 9.0 NBS newsreel 9.25 Symphony Orchestra 10.0 Music, mirth and melody.
